Report: Giants wouldn't include Eldridge in trades for stars
Briefly

The Giants have been proactive in their pursuit of adding talent, notably making serious offers for Kyle Tucker and Garrett Crochet to bolster their roster.
Despite their efforts to acquire notable players like Tucker, the Giants were hesitant to part with top prospect Bryce Eldridge, valuing his potential highly.
Rival executives have lauded the Giants' new baseball operations group as 'hyperactive' in trade discussions, indicating a strong desire to improve the team.
Eldridge is seen as not just a top prospect, but one with All-Star potential who could impact the Giants as early as the 2025 season.
